A Ponemon Institute study has found that 90 percent of businesses experienced a data breach in the past year, and attacks were more severe and difficult to prevent. Network World reports that mobile devices--employee laptops, smartphones and tablets--are responsible for most breaches, while business partnerships also elevate risk. Fifty-three percent of businesses reported a low level of confidence in their ability to avoid future attacks, which the authors attribute to "the fact that so many organizations are having multiple breaches." An MSNBC report outlines ways for individuals to protect themselves in light of the recent "seemingly endless string" of data breaches, and according to the report, most aren't made public. Meanwhile, CIO has posted an online quiz to test readers' knowledge of data breaches.
